Job Summary

and key responsibilities:




Reporting to the Team Manager/Head of Centre, Romans are seeking an Inventory Administrator to join our dedicated and dynamic team based in

Pride Park, Derby

. As a Inventory Administrator, experience is beneficial but not essential. You will play a pivotal role in ensuring our customers receive the highest level of service and support.


K

ey Responsibilities:



Assisting the compliance manager and property managers in an administrative capacity Booking of property visits Corresponding with customers via both phone and email Data entry - both company internal CRM and Microsoft Office Imputing data into Excel Spreadsheets to a high standard Photocopying, scanning and filing Running errands within and outside of the office Taking and transcribing meeting minutes.

What are we looking for:



Excellent communication, written and verbal Professional telephone manner Organisational skills, time management and attention to detail
